Output 21d23faa97b0ac836cc4bdb1cf7d64fd27e361f729b4d85eb5709ea4de45e729:8

value
1567000
script pubkey
OP_0 OP_PUSHBYTES_20 db6f0451e8f74bc36828b2a9d063a6d9848dac34
address
bc1qmdhsg50g7a9ux6pgk25aqcaxmxzgmtp52tjlkw
transaction
21d23faa97b0ac836cc4bdb1cf7d64fd27e361f729b4d85eb5709ea4de45e729
spent
true